We announced on Facebook this week our #motorcycle trip #MotoGuat2017 from San Miguel de Allende to Guatemala in February. We’ve ridden much of Mexico, US and Canada by motorcycle and now we’re adding Guatemala to the list.

Motorcycling is one way we satisfy our adventurous side. We can feel the air, smell the land and connect with people more easily than traveling by car. It’s also very meditative. One has to be present to ride.

FINDING  BEAUTY
by Gwen Mazer

Beauty knows no bounds, she is to be found everywhere.  She awes us with her stunning variations, in the spirit of nature with a walk in the woods, the infinite shapes and colors to be found in a flower, the fluttering of a hummingbird, the sparkle and roar of the sea. We are moved by the symphony of light, the sunrise, sunset, touched by the brilliance of the moon on a crystal clear night, surprised by the colors in a puddle after the rain.

Beauty manifests as joy in the delight and wonder of a gaggle of little children, the sound of their chatter, the colorful bouquet of their assorted clothing, and the air of innocence as they go ambling down the street hand in hand.

Beauty takes our breathe away with the fluid movement and grace of a ballerina, thrills us with the soaring flight of a modern dancer as he leaps gracefully through space, sends us into a moment of heavenly grace on the notes of music exquisitely played.

Physical beauty can be joyful to behold, can cause pain and anguish if we indulge in comparison or mistake glamour for real beauty. It can unravel our minds with desire, rage, envy, or lust. It can cause us to lose our senses, to forget the real source of beauty the light that shines from within.

In beauty is the embrace of true connection, serenity, compassion, love of the face lined with years of living, the delight of a baby born brand new, the eros of true love found and consummated, empathy, caring and deep intention to understand the feelings of another.

Beauty of being is discovered in our vulnerability, when we are willing to be truly seen by another. Beauty is found in our willingness to explore our perceptions, our thoughts, when we let go of our ideas of the other and realize we are all part of the human family.

Beauty can visit in unexpected moments, times when we have been cracked open enough to hear the quiet whisper of our inner voice and we listen. We may be guided to a fork in the road, to a path untraveled. We trust beauty to be our guide and travel onward as she lights our way towards wisdom and well-being.
